Company Overview

Pet Valu Holdings Ltd. is a Canadian specialty pet food and pet supplies retailer operating in the pet care and specialty retail industries. The company focuses on the sale of premium and super‑premium pet food, treats, toys, and accessories, serving pet owners through a combination of corporate-owned and independently franchised stores, as well as a wholesale distribution business. Its revenue is primarily driven by recurring consumable products, particularly pet food, which represents the largest share of sales.

The company differentiates itself through a strong franchise-led retail model, a broad portfolio of private-label brands, and an emphasis on premium nutrition and pet wellness. Founded in 1976, Pet Valu expanded nationally across Canada over several decades, was taken private by a private equity sponsor in 2016, and returned to public markets through an initial public offering in 2021. Since then, it has pursued disciplined store growth, private brand expansion, and strategic acquisitions to strengthen its market position.

Business Operations

Pet Valu operates through two primary business segments: Retail and Wholesale. The Retail segment consists of a network of corporate-owned and franchised stores operating under banners such as Pet Valu, Paulmac’s Pet Food, Total Pet, Bosley’s by Pet Valu, and Tisol, generating revenue from in-store and digital sales. The Wholesale segment distributes pet food and supplies to independently owned pet specialty retailers, providing scale advantages in sourcing, logistics, and brand distribution.

The company controls an integrated distribution network, centralized procurement, and a growing e-commerce platform supporting omnichannel sales. Key subsidiaries include Pet Valu Canada Inc. and Pet Valu Distribution Inc., which manage retail operations and supply chain activities. In addition to national brand products, Pet Valu develops and sells proprietary brands, including Performatrin, Nutrience, and Great Jack’s, which support margin stability and brand loyalty.

Strategic Position & Investments

Pet Valu’s strategy emphasizes sustainable growth through new store openings, selective acquisitions, and expansion of private-label offerings. A major strategic investment was the acquisition of Ren’s Pets, a specialty pet retailer in Ontario, which expanded the company’s store base, premium positioning, and customer reach. The company continues to invest in supply chain automation, digital capabilities, and loyalty programs to enhance customer engagement.

The company is also positioned to benefit from long-term trends in pet humanization and premiumization, with ongoing investments in exclusive nutrition products and pet wellness categories. Its franchise model allows for capital-efficient expansion while maintaining localized customer service and operational discipline.

Geographic Footprint

Pet Valu’s operations are concentrated primarily in Canada, where it maintains a coast-to-coast retail and distribution presence. The company’s headquarters is located in Ontario, and its store network spans British Columbia, Alberta, Saskatchewan, Manitoba, Ontario, Quebec, and Atlantic Canada.

Through its Wholesale segment, Pet Valu also supplies independent pet retailers in parts of the United States, giving the company limited but established cross-border exposure. While Canada remains its core market, its distribution capabilities provide optionality for broader North American reach.

Leadership & Governance

Pet Valu is led by an experienced executive team with backgrounds in specialty retail, consumer goods, and supply chain management. Leadership emphasizes disciplined capital allocation, franchise partnership, and long-term value creation through operational excellence and brand differentiation.

Key executives include:

  • Richard LandtPresident & Chief Executive Officer
  • David BestChief Financial Officer
  • Bob BissellChief Operating Officer

The company’s governance framework aligns management incentives with shareholder returns and supports strategic execution within a competitive and evolving retail environment.
